BUSINESS NEWS

  • Market Basket announced that its interim CEO is retiring after more than 40 years with the company in Manchester; Donald Mulligan, who served 27 years as CFO and took over last September, will be succeeded by Chuck Casazza, who began as a bagger + later became director of operations.  WMUR
  • At the Stonyfield facility in Londonderry, production runs at 310 bottles per minute with about 60,000 cases per week of organic yogurt made with pure ingredients. The company supports local family farms and donates samples (over $1 million worth last year) to help those in need.  WMUR
  • Blue Ribbon Dry Cleaners, New Hampshire's oldest dry cleaner, continues a family legacy nearly a century later as its machines hum and hangers clash+ serving local patrons with a storied tradition.  New Hampshire Union Leader

CULTURE NEWS

  • Runnymede Farm in North Hampton will host a Kentucky Derby party tomorrow to honor Dancer’s Image (the controversial 1968 winning horse disqualified after testing positive for bute), with the farm displaying its trophy as a lasting tribute.  WMUR

ECONOMY NEWS

  • Regular gas hit about $4.25 a gallon Friday, up 27 cents from last week and 10 cents from yesterday as the war in Iran disrupted supply and left local drivers searching for cheaper fuel.  WMUR
  • Consumer Reports highlights May as a month for savings with upcoming Mother's Day deals on beauty items, cookware and tech (such as smartwatches) and future Memorial Day sales offering discounts on major appliances, mattresses and grills. Shoppers are advised to check product details like size and energy efficiency before purchasing.  WMUR

SPORTS NEWS

  • Bishop Guertin beat Londonderry 14-4 in a six-inning baseball game today at Nashua using four pitchers and key hits that shifted the momentum in BG's favor; Coach Painter praised the team and said they will mix pitching looks in upcoming games.  Nashua Ink Link
